数据库sql语句学习,什么sql语句是操作数据库表记录的
- 数据库
- 2023-08-29
- 102
今天给各位分享数据库sql语句学习的知识,其中也会对什么sql语句是操作数据库表记录的进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!什么sql语...
今天给各位分享数据库sql语句学习的知识,其中也会对什么sql语句是操作数据库表记录的进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
什么sql语句是操作数据库表记录的
数据库sql语句可以分成3类。
一是数据操纵语句,即DML,它们可以对数据库进行增删改查操作;第二类是数据定义语句,即DDL,它们用来定义数据表结构、创建视图、删除数据库表等操作;第三类是数据库控制语句,即DCL。它们用于设置或更改数据库的访问权限等。DML是操作数据库表记录的
sql是mysql数据库的专属语言吗
sql不是mysql数据库的专属语言
sql语言是一种特殊目的的编程语言,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件的扩展名。结构化查询语言是高级的非过程化编程语言,允许用户在高层数据结构上工作。它不要求用户指定对数据的存放方法,也不需要用户了解具体的数据存放方式,所以具有完全不同底层结构的不同数据库系统,可以使用相同的结构化查询语言作为数据输入与管理的接口。结构化查询语言语句可以嵌套,这使它具有极大的灵活性和强大的功能
1987年得到国际标准组织的支持下成为国际标准。不过各种通行的数据库系统在其实践过程中都对SQL规范作了某些编改和扩充。所以,实际上不同数据库系统之间的SQL不能完全相互通用。
ACCESS数据库,SQL查询,SQL语句
1、首先我们打开电脑里的Access2010软件,软件会默认开启一个表名为【表1】的空白表单。
2、将空白表单表名修改为【测试表】,添加字段和几行测试数据。
3、默认软件工具栏是【开始】工具栏,我们点击【创建】进入创建工具栏,在工具栏中点击【查询设计】。
4、弹出【显示表】窗口,点击【关闭】将该窗口关掉。
5、这时软件会进入【设计】工具栏,我们点击工具栏左侧的【SQL视图】。
6、【SQL视图】默认选择的是【设计视图】,我们在下拉菜单中选择【SQL视图】。
7、在工具栏下方会自动打开一个查询窗口,在这里就可以输入查询用的SQL语句了。
8、我们输入一行标准的SQL查询语句,查询在【测试表】中性别为‘女’的数据,点击【运行】。
9、SQL语句执行完成后,查询窗口会自动转换为表视图,以表格方式显示查询到的数据。
学习SQL大概需要多长时间呢
我认为1周就足够了。
基本上SQL是用于CRUD(创建,读取,更新,删除)操作,它有两个方面
学习有关基本的DML和DDL语句,选择列表,WHERE子句表达式,联接,简单的GROUPBY/HAVING,ORDERBY等基本知识就足够了.
基本的DML和DDL。简单的WHERE表达式。连接和它们的语法,包括LEFT/RIGHTJOIN。最好是如果你知道“旧”JOIN语法(不使用JOIN关键字)和“新”JOIN语法。ORDERBY,以及在ORDERBY语句中有多个列的意思。GROUPBY/HAVING-这些用法较少,但如果您需要它们,它们通常是唯一有效的工作方式。无论你的数据库引擎用什么“LIMIT<N>”语法。不幸的是,不同的数据库做这些略有不同,但这是查询中非常常用。简单的子查询-你有时需要这些,特别是[NOT]EXISTS。学习常量子查询和相关子查询之间的区别也很好。了解主键,外键和索引。学习一些关于事务的基础知识,包括自动提交,启动事务,提交和回滚等。一些简单的数据库设计数据库SQL如何删除数据,delete语句的使用方法
数据库SQL如何删除数据,delete语句的使用方法。
1、创建一个临时表,用于演示sqlserver语法中delete删除的使用方法IFOBJECT_ID('tempdb..#tblDelete')ISNOTNULLDROPTABLE#tblDelete;CREATETABLE#tblDelete(Codevarchar(50),Totalint);
2、往临时表#tblDelete中插入几行测试,用于演示如何删除数据insertinto#tblDelete(Code,Total)values('Code1',30);insertinto#tblDelete(Code,Total)values('Code2',40);insertinto#tblDelete(Code,Total)values('Code3',50);insertinto#tblDelete(Code,Total)values('Code4',6);
3、查询临时表#tblDelete中的测试数据select*from#tblDelete;
4、删除临时表#tblDelete中Code栏位=Code3的记录,使用下面的delete语句delete#tblDeletewhereCode='Code3'
5、再次查询临时表#tblDelete的结果,可以看到Code3的记录没有了select*from#tblDelete;
6、删除临时表#tblDelete中Code栏位=Code2的记录,使用下面的delete语句。注意,下面的delete语句后面有一个from关键字,这个关键字是可以省略的,但是建议不要省略deletefrom#tblDeletewhereCode='Code2'
7、再次查询临时表#tblDelete的结果,可以看到Code2的记录没有了select*from#tblDelete;
8、最后,如果想要快速的删除表中的所有数据,有下面两种方式。第二种方式速度更快deletefrom#tblDelete;truncatetable#tblDelete;
SQL数据库
SQL(StructuredQueryLanguage)是具有数据操纵和数据定义等多种功能的数据库语言,这种语言具有交互性特点,能为用户提供极大的便利,数据库管理系统应充分利用SQL语言提高计算机应用系统的工作质量与效率。SQL语言不仅能独立应用于终端,还可以作为子...
河南新华电脑学院
文章到此结束,如果本次分享的数据库sql语句学习和什么sql语句是操作数据库表记录的的问题解决了您的问题,那么我们由衷的感到高兴!
本文链接:http://www.xinin56.com/su/11625.html